Description
A hearty and comforting crockpot creamy potato and hamburger soupโmade with ground beef, tender potatoes, and a creamy, flavorful broth. Perfect for cozy nights or easy meal prep.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 small onion, diced
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 4 cups diced potatoes (Yukon Gold or Russet)
- 2 carrots, sliced
- 2 celery stalks, chopped
- 4 cups beef broth
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1/2 tsp dried thyme
- 1/2 tsp paprika
- 1 cup heavy cream or half-and-half
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 2 tbsp cornstarch mixed with 2 tbsp cold water (optional, for thickening)
Instructions
- 1. In a skillet over medium heat, cook ground beef with diced onion and garlic until browned. Drain excess fat.
- 2. Transfer cooked beef mixture to the crockpot.
- 3. Add diced potatoes, carrots, celery, beef broth, salt, pepper, thyme, and paprika.
- 4. Cover and cook on low for 7โ8 hours or high for 3โ4 hours, until vegetables are tender.
- 5. Stir in heavy cream and shredded cheddar cheese. Let melt and combine.
- 6. If a thicker consistency is desired, stir in the cornstarch slurry and cook on high for an additional 15โ20 minutes until thickened.
- 7.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ed. Serve hot.
Notes
- Great served with crusty bread or crackers.
- Use ground turkey or sausage as an alternative to beef.
- Leftovers store well in the fridge for up to 4 days or freeze for up to 2 months.
